Latest Patents
Fujita's latest patents showcase his expertise in creating advanced polymer compositions. One of his noteworthy inventions is a flame-retardant flexible polymer composition. This composition includes a polymer component that consists of 98 to 80 parts by mass of chlorinated polyethylene and 2 to 20 parts by mass of a polyolefin polymer. Additionally, it incorporates calcium hydroxide particles, which help improve fire safety and automation. The formulation allows for the creation of polymer tubes and insulated wires designed from this flame-retardant flexible polymer composition.
Another significant patent involves a heat-shrinkable tube and heat-shrinkable cap meant for waterproofing electrical wire bundles. These products include an adhesive layer on the inner surface, which utilizes a low-viscosity resin capable of providing effective waterproofing by merely being placed over the exposed portions of electrical wires. This innovation ensures ease of use and enhances the reliability of electrical installations.
